How to prepare for a job interview at Think Trevor James Recruitment Ltd
✨Know Your Numbers
Before the interview, brush up on your sales metrics and achievements. Be ready to discuss specific figures like your conversion rates, revenue generated, and how you’ve successfully opened new client relationships in the past. This shows you’re not just a talker but someone who delivers results.
✨Master the Art of Cold Calling
Since this role is all about high-volume outbound calls, practice your pitch. Prepare for common objections and think about how you can turn them into opportunities. Role-playing with a friend or colleague can help you feel more confident and articulate during the actual interview.
✨Showcase Your Resilience
Be ready to share examples of how you've bounced back from rejection or setbacks in your sales career. Highlighting your resilience will demonstrate that you have the right mindset for a pure new business role where persistence is key.
✨Leverage LinkedIn Effectively
Since the job requires using LinkedIn for outreach, come prepared with examples of how you’ve used the platform to generate leads or build your personal brand. Discuss any successful campaigns or connections you've made that led to new business opportunities.
